fix: validate script_path exists + tell agent to call generate_job_file

Two problems with the prior prepare_submit_job flow:

  1. The agent could pass a script_path that only existed in its own
     context (LLM-generated code not yet on disk) or a path on the host
     filesystem that's invisible inside the container. The new check
     surfaces this as a 400 with a clear remediation hint instead of
     letting spark-submit fail later with an opaque FileNotFoundError -> 500.

  2. The container-isolation issue: any path the agent gives is interpreted
     inside the container. The two ways a file can legitimately exist there
     are (a) generate_job_file(code=...) just wrote it to
     SPARK_EXECUTOR_JOBS_DIR (the default ./data/jobs/ is the only
     gitignored dir that survives restarts), or (b) a host dir was
     mounted via -v. The error message spells both out so an agent can
     self-correct.

Implementation:
  - submit.py: new _check_script_path() that raises ValueError (-> 400)
    when the path is missing, empty, or a directory. Called in both
    prepare_submit_job and confirm_submit_job (defense in depth).
  - prepare_submit_job checks the connection FIRST (KeyError -> 404)
    before the script (ValueError -> 400), so an agent with both problems
    sees the more fundamental 'unknown connection' error first.
  - server.py / requests.py: route description and Pydantic field
    description spell out the generate_job_file pattern so an LLM
    reading the tool schema learns the right next step.

8 new tests; 8 existing tests adjusted to create real files (they used
synthetic /tmp/*.py paths that don't exist).
